Understanding Allicin: The Magic Behind Garlic
The magic of garlic largely lies in a compound called allicin. This powerful compound has numerous health properties, but it's not present in its active form when you first chew on a clove. Just like when using epoxy, both parts must be mixed for the glue to work. For garlic, you must break down the fresco clove to activate allicin. Crush, chop, or mince the garlic clove, then let it sit for about 3-5 minutes. This waiting period allows the alliin and alliinase to mix properly, leading to the formation of allicin and its fabulous health benefits.
Cooking Garlic: Timing is Everything
Many of us love the fragrance and taste of garlic in cooking, but timing is everything concerning its health benefits. A common mistake is tossing minced garlic into a hot pan at the beginning of cooking. Doing this often results in the high heat breaking down allicin before it can provide benefits. To retain its health perks, add crushed garlic at the end of the cooking process or better yet, consume it raw in your meals. Try adding freshly minced garlic to dressings or finish your dishes with raw garlic for an added health kick.
Don’t Eat It Whole: Why Method Matters
One of the most common misconceptions is that swallowing whole garlic cloves is an effective way to reap its health benefits. Unfortunately, this approach does not allow for the necessary chemical reaction to create allicin. If you're simply gulping them down like pills, you’re missing out on essential nutrients. Remember to crush, chop, or mince each clove for the best results!
Moderation is Key: The Ideal Daily Dose
While garlic is incredibly beneficial, consuming too much can be harmful. The ideal daily dosage is one to two cloves. Beyond that, you risk experiencing negative side effects, like digestive discomfort or toxicity. Staying within this dose maximizes health benefits while minimizing any unwanted reactions.

The Wisdom of Eating Garlic With Food
Another common mistake made by wellness enthusiasts is consuming garlic on an empty stomach. While some proponents tout 'empty stomach garlic benefits,' this practice can lead to digestive irritation. Instead, pair your garlic with food to not only maximize its benefits but also make it easier on your stomach. Try adding raw garlic to hummus or guacamole, or stirring it into yogurt for a tasty and healthful snack.
